So the great dragon was cast out, that serpent of old, called the Devil and Satan, who deceives the whole world; he was cast to the earth, and his angels were cast out with him. Then I heard a loud voice saying in heaven, “Now salvation, and strength, and the kingdom of our God, and the power of His Christ have come, for the accuser of our brethren, who accused them before our God day and night, has been cast down. And they overcame him by the blood of the Lamb and by the word of their testimony, and they did not love their lives to the death. Therefore rejoice, O heavens, and you who dwell in them! Woe to the inhabitants of the earth and the sea! For the devil has come down to you, having great wrath, because he knows that he has a short time.”
Revelation 12:9-12
Here we have the results of the crucifixion and the resurrection. Satan was cast to earth so that he could never go to heaven again to accuse us like he did Job. The accuser has been cast down so that he can only accuse us to each other not before God. We are able to overcome him by the testimony we have in the blood of the Lamb and by not loving our lives more than the Lamb. Now heaven is rejoicing to be rid of the trouble-maker. Here on earth it is a different story. We are the ghetto of the universe where Satan and his angels are quarantined. We are under his intense attack because he knows that his time is limited.
The result of God’s limiting Satan is that we are left to overcome him until the end of his time. This is good news for the universe in general but bad news for those of us who have to live in his neighborhood. God has not thrown a bully that we cannot stop into our lives. No, He has given us tools to build a great life that doesn’t end here. He has given us weapons to defeat the enemy of our soul so that we do not need to live in fear. We have only to stand in the strength that He has given us.
